Submillimeter Wave Production by Upshifted Reflection from a Moving Ionization Front.

Abstract

The Doppler shift and reflection coefficients are calculated for reflection of an EM wave from a moving ionization front in a stationary gas. It is suggested that this process can be used to upshift microwaves to submillimeter waves. (Author)
